Deck Paint vs. Deck Stain: What is the Difference?

Both protect your deck, but they create different looks.

  • Deck paint covers the surface with a complete film and offers a wide range of color choices. It is a popular choice for concrete and wood decks where you want full, even coverage.
  • Deck stain gives a more natural look that lets the grain of wood or the character of stone show through. It is often chosen for wood and stone surfaces.

Whichever you choose, we use a high quality solvent base for increased durability so the finish stands up to sun, water, and pool chemicals.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between deck paint and deck stain?

Paint covers the deck with a complete film and offers more color choices, while stain gives a more natural look that lets the grain or texture show through. We will help you choose the right option for your surface and the look you want.

How do I maintain a stained pool deck?

Maintenance is simple. Sweep away dust regularly and occasionally clean with water and a neutral pH cleanser to remove stubborn dirt.
